Kezza is a diminutive form of the name Keziah, which originates from the Hebrew word 'qetsiah,' meaning 'cassia tree' or 'cinnamon.' Cassia is a spice similar to cinnamon, symbolizing sweetness and warmth. Historically, Keziah appears in the Bible as one of Job’s daughters, representing beauty and renewal after hardship.

Cultural Significance of Kezza

The name Keziah, from which Kezza derives, holds biblical significance as one of Job’s daughters, symbolizing restoration and beauty after suffering. In Jewish culture, the cassia tree was valued for its aromatic bark used in religious anointings and perfumes. Over time, Kezza has evolved as a charming, affectionate form, especially popular in English-speaking countries as a friendly and approachable name.
